Lubetkin Field Rededicated on NJIT Day 2004


Shown here at the ribbon-cutting ceremony are Lenny Kaplan, athletic director; Dr. Altenkirch; Mal Simon, professor emeritus of physical education and athletics; and Charles R. Dees, Jr., vice president for advancement.
October 25, 2004

A highlight of the first annual NJIT Day festivities on Oct. 23 was the rededication of the Lubetkin Soccer Field. In his remarks, NJIT President Robert A. Altenkirch said that the upgrade of the field was important not only for intercollegiate athletics, but for the use and enjoyment of all students, faculty and staff through intramurals and recreational activities. “Many of the young women and men who compete in intercollegiate athletics for NJIT will remember the experience vividly for the rest of their lives,” said Altenkirch. “It is important that we provide a quality experience for them, and, in turn, build the pride and alumni support that raises the currency of the NJIT degree even further.”
